That frequency ceiling covers the highest-speed serial links — 10G/25G Ethernet reference clocks, JESD204B SYSREF, and RF sampling converters — without needing a divider on the front end. The 4:16 input-to-output ratio means four independent input paths feed sixteen outputs. For a system with multiple clock domains — FPGA core, transceiver, ADC, DAC — one device cleans and fans out all the references, eliminating separate PLLs per rail. ## Signal format flexibility and the BGA footprint Inputs accept HCSL, HSDS, LCPECL, LVCMOS, LVDS, and LVPECL; outputs deliver HCSL, HSDS, LVDS, and LVPECL. That covers the common differential signalling standards in base station, test equipment, and data converter designs — no external level translation between the oscillator and the downstream loads. The 144-NFBGA (10x10 mm) package has a 0.8 mm ball pitch — standard for a BGA this size.","metaTitle":"TI LMK04616ZCRR Jitter Cleaner, PLL, 2GHz, 144-BGA","metaDescription":"Texas Instruments LMK04616ZCRR jitter cleaner with PLL, 2GHz max frequency, 4:16 I/O ratio.
